So I was just reading in another section of the forum where heights were being mentioned and it got me wondering how tall some of these pros are. I am 6'2'' and I feel that height makes it harder to look big than it is for someone much shorter. Now that I am bigger than most guys in the gym I am thankful for my tall stature.
I have always wondering if the pros are big and tall, or big and short. I feel like there is a HUGE difference there. So here are some heights I pulled off the web. I realize guys like Arnold supposedly claim different heights during their age. Having back problems I can vouch for those who say you can get shorter as you age.
These are just numbers I pulled quickly off google without fact-checking.
Arnold: 6'2''
Cutler: 5'8''
Ronnie Coleman: 5'8''
Branch Warren: 5'7''
Kai: 5'9''
Phil Heath: 5'9''
Dorian Yates: 5'10''
Larry Scott: 5'7''
Sergio Oliva: 5'10''
None of these heights seem too far away from the average. I was hoping to find some closer to 5' or over 6'
